(ad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|| []).push({});after-content-x4 Tom Fecht studied cybernetics and art history in Berlin and New York. Since 1969 he has organized Happenings, Fluxus campaigns, land art projects, installations and exhibitions in Germany and abroad. In 1972 he opened the Elephant Press Gallery , only in Dresdener Strasse [first] on Oranienplatz and later at Zossener Stra\u00dfe 32 in Berlin-Kreuzberg. [2] [3] [4] [5] In 1978 he founded together with Patric Feest, Wieland Giebel, Norbert Gravius \u200b\u200b(later Federal Treasurer of the Party) [6] , Rabut Schmidt [7] and Erik Weih\u00f6nig [8] the Elephant Press Verlag based on Oranienstrasse. Until 1992 Tom Fecht was an author, editor and curator of publications and exhibitions on art, design, satire and contemporary history. He practiced teaching at the Berlin University of Applied Sciences, the Hamburg University of Fine Arts and the Royal College of Art in London. (ad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|| []).push({});after-content-x4Tom Fecht lives and works in Berlin, London and in the French department of Finist\u00e8re.
